Output d89078a4c235c37a4ce7ef2253b2314346215d2fea96a6cbe6a0d7be39079fbe:21

value
25650301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03015992821ef5c017116f8ef7be3b975b674b01 OP_EQUAL
address
M8B3soE4zrREZM59Hr75XN1TVHqeyCLGmi
transaction
d89078a4c235c37a4ce7ef2253b2314346215d2fea96a6cbe6a0d7be39079fbe
spent
true